Manchester City midfielder Jesus Navas insists their Champions League hopes are not over.
Next week they will all be back in Spain, Catalonia to be precise, facing mission improbable as they try to overturn a 2-0 deficit to Barcelona.
"I think we can go there and make a statement," he said. "We can go and do something very important. It's possible. I think we can go and give a good account of ourselves.
"We will fight to the end," Navas told the Manchester Evening News.
